Linux服务器ChatGPT部署注意事项

AI技术
小华
2025-07-19

在Linux服务器上部署ChatGPT时,有几个关键的注意事项需要考虑,以确保系统的稳定性、安全性和性能。以下是一些重要的注意事项:

硬件和软件要求

  • 硬件要求:选择性能强劲的服务器,至少4核心CPU,16GB内存,推荐使用SSD硬盘以提高读写速度。
  • 软件要求
  • 安装Python 3.6或更高版本。
  • 安装pip作为包管理工具。
  • 安装Git用于克隆ChatGPT的源代码。

操作系统和依赖管理

  • 使用Linux发行版,如Ubuntu或CentOS。
  • 通过虚拟环境管理Python依赖,避免不同项目之间的依赖冲突。

网络和API接口配置

  • 开发RESTful API接口,如使用Flask或Django框架,以便客户端与模型交互。
  • 配置Web服务器(如Nginx或Apache)来暴露API接口,并设置防火墙规则以确保安全性。

性能优化

  • 监控系统资源使用情况,如CPU、内存和磁盘I/O,确保服务器运行在最佳状态。
  • 根据监控数据调整模型的批处理大小和并行运行策略,以最大化利用服务器资源。

稳定性保障

  • 实现自动重启机制,以防应用崩溃或错误。
  • 定期备份模型权重和数据,以便在发生故障时能够快速恢复。
  • 设置故障转移机制,确保系统连续性。

安全措施

  • 强化网络安全性,设置合理的访问权限。
  • 使用SSL/TLS加密通信,防止数据在传输中被截获。
  • 定期更新操作系统和所有依赖包,以修复可能的安全漏洞。

模型选择和定制

  • 从官方或可靠资源处下载预训练的ChatGPT模型文件。
  • 根据特定需求,对模型进行定制化调整,以提高模型的准确性和效率。

成本考虑

  • 对于中大型应用,建议使用云服务器,并根据实际需求选择适当的配置,以降低成本。

通过遵循上述注意事项,您可以确保在Linux服务器上部署的ChatGPT系统既稳定又安全,同时也能满足您的特定需求。

亿速云提供售前/售后服务

售前业务咨询

售后技术保障

400-100-2938

7*24小时售后电话

官方微信小程序